WebJun 17, 2024 · Tips for Making the Best Prune Puree To store in the fridge: Add to small airtight containers and refrigerate for 3-5 days. To freeze: Add to a silicone ice cube tray and freeze overnight. Transfer frozen cubes to a zip top freezer bag and seal, removing as much air as possible. Freeze for up to 6 months.
